realme 14 Pro+

Strengths

For $27,999, the Realme 14 Pro+ is a killer package that offers great value for money.
The device features a good display that provides super battery life, reliable cameras, and impressive performance.
The phone's 120Hz refresh rate is optimized well by Realme, making everything feel super snappy and responsive.
The device comes with a huge 6,000 mAh battery that can last for 1.5 to 2 days on heavy use.
The 80 W charger quickly charges the phone from 0 to 100% in about 45-55 minutes.
The Realme 14 Pro+ is highly recommendable, especially considering its competitive price point.

Weaknesses

The device lacks NFC, which may be a surprise for some users, but it's not a deal-breaker since many people don't use this feature.
The phone comes with a lot of bloatware apps pre-installed, which can be annoying and take up storage space.
There is no headphone jack on the Realme 14 Pro+, which may be a drawback for some users who prefer wired audio connections.
The device's storage type is UFS 3.1, but it would have been nice to see faster storage options like UFS 4.0 or even SSD storage.
The phone's interface is optimized well, but the app drawer can feel cluttered with all the pre-installed apps and bloatware.
There are some minor complaints about the device's performance in certain benchmarks, although it still performs well in day-to-day use.

Honor 100 Pro

The Honor 100 Pro boasts a sleek design with curved sides, a slim metal-free frame, and a unique camera module that sets it apart from other phones in the market. The phone's front features a capsule Notch at the center, known as a dynamic Island, which houses the selfie camera. The back has a slightly raised camera module at the bottom, with a speaker grille and microphone on either side. Under the hood, the Honor 100 Pro is powered by the high-performance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 processor, paired with up to 16GB of RAM and 1TB storage. The phone's display boasts a 6.78-inch 1.5K OLED panel with a refresh rate of 120Hz, diamond-like pixel arrangements, and peak brightness of up to 2,600 nits. The camera setup is impressive, featuring a triple-camera configuration on the rear, including a 50MP primary sensor with optical image stabilization, a 32MP telephoto lens, and a 12MP ultra-wide-angle camera. The front boasts a 50MP main camera and 2MP depth sensor. A 5,000mAh battery powers the device, supporting up to 100W fast charging, which can reach 50% in just 10 minutes. Additionally, it supports 66W wireless charging for faster top-ups. The Honor 100 Pro is priced competitively at around £370 in the UK and $470 in the USA (base variant starts from Chinese yuan in China). Overall, this phone impresses with its outstanding performance, above-average camera capabilities, and sleek design.
